Recent AI ethics opinions, including Florida Bar’s Advisory Opinion 24-1, confirm that lawyers can use AI tools while upholding client confidentiality, ensuring accurate and competent practice, avoiding unethical billing, and complying with advertising restrictions. These opinions signal an increasing acceptance by bar associations regarding the innovative use of AI in the legal domain.

Despite some lawyers’ fears, no bar associations have taken a definitive stance against AI utility in law. Instead, states like California and Florida are providing frameworks for lawyers looking to leverage AI to enhance their services.

Essentials from Florida’s AI Ethics Opinion:

  • Use of AI is permissible in law practice with adherence to professional obligations.
  • Client confidentiality must be safeguarded when using AI technologies.
  • Final responsibility for the accuracy of AI-generated work products lies with the lawyer.
  • Billing must be ethical and transparent when AI tools are employed.
  • Lawyers must clarify the use of AI in client communications and advertising, ensuring clients are not misled.

For firms in states where specific AI ethics opinions have not yet been released, it's wise to look to the practices outlined by proactive states. At the same time, reviewing the current rules of professional conduct can help identify any potential conflicts with planned AI integrations.
